Germination Stage

Duration of Germination ๐ŸŒฑ

Germination for the Philodendron 'Red Back' typically takes about 2 to 4 weeks. This timeframe can vary based on temperature and moisture levels, so keep an eye on those conditions.

Conditions for Successful Germination ๐ŸŒก๏ธ

To ensure successful germination, aim for an optimal temperature range of 24ยฐC to 30ยฐC (75ยฐF to 86ยฐF). Use a well-draining, moist potting mix and provide indirect sunlight or shade to create the perfect environment.

Notable Changes During Germination ๐Ÿ‘€

During this stage, you'll notice the emergence of cotyledons, the initial leaves that provide essential energy for growth. Additionally, the development of the root system begins, establishing anchorage and enabling nutrient uptake.

Seedling Stage

Duration of Seedling Growth ๐ŸŒฑ

The seedling stage of the Philodendron 'Red Back' lasts about 4 to 8 weeks. During this time, the plant transitions from its initial growth phase to developing true leaves.

Characteristics of Seedlings ๐ŸŒฟ

At this stage, seedlings typically reach a height of 2 to 4 inches. Their leaves are small and heart-shaped, showcasing minimal red pigmentation, which will evolve as the plant matures.

Vegetative Growth Stage

Duration of Vegetative Growth ๐ŸŒฑ

The vegetative growth stage of the Philodendron 'Red Back' can last anywhere from 6 months to several years. This variability largely depends on environmental conditions, such as light, water, and nutrients.

Growth Patterns and Leaf Development ๐Ÿƒ

During this phase, you'll notice significant changes in the plant's growth patterns. Leaf size can increase dramatically, reaching lengths of up to 12 inches.

Color Changes ๐ŸŽจ

As the plant matures, the leaves undergo a stunning transformation. They develop deeper red tones, adding to the plant's visual appeal and showcasing its vibrant nature.

Flowering Stage

Duration of Flowering ๐ŸŒธ

The flowering stage of the Philodendron 'Red Back' typically unfolds in late spring to early summer. This vibrant period lasts about 2 to 4 weeks, offering a brief but spectacular display.

Characteristics of Flowers ๐ŸŒผ

During this stage, the plant produces an inflorescence, which features a spadix encased in a spathe. The flowers themselves are striking, showcasing a palette that ranges from white to cream, adding a touch of elegance to your plant collection.

Seed Production Stage

Duration of Seed Production ๐ŸŒฑ

The seed production stage lasts about 4-6 months, starting from the flowering phase until the seeds reach maturity. This period is crucial for the successful propagation of Philodendron 'Red Back'.

Conditions for Successful Seed Production ๐ŸŒก๏ธ

For optimal seed production, maintaining consistent humidity and warmth is essential. Additionally, successful pollination plays a vital role in developing healthy seeds.

Notable Changes During This Stage ๐Ÿ”

During this stage, you'll notice the development of small, round seeds nestled within the fruit. The plant also shifts its energy focus, diverting resources from leaf growth to seed production, which is a fascinating transformation.

Growth Rate and Maturation

How Long Until Fully Grown? ๐ŸŒฑ

The Philodendron 'Red Back' typically takes about 2-3 years to reach full maturity. This timeframe can vary based on environmental conditions and care.

Factors Influencing Growth Rate ๐Ÿ’จ

Light availability plays a crucial role in accelerating growth. More light means faster growth, so positioning your plant wisely can make a significant difference.

Water and nutrient levels also impact growth speed. Providing adequate care, including regular watering and fertilization, enhances the plant's overall health and growth rate.

Notable Changes Throughout the Life Cycle ๐ŸŒฟ

As the plant matures, you'll notice changes in leaf color and size. The leaves transition from small, heart-shaped forms to larger, more vibrant ones.

Climbing behavior is another fascinating aspect. As the Philodendron 'Red Back' grows taller, it requires support, showcasing its natural climbing ability. This characteristic not only adds to its beauty but also enhances its overall vitality.
